首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

每次递归调用函数之间的延迟

是指在递归算法中,每次调用函数自身时所产生的一种时间延迟。这个延迟是由于函数调用的开销和计算机处理能力的限制而产生的。

在递归算法中,当函数调用自身时,计算机需要保存当前函数的执行状态,并为新的函数调用分配内存空间。这个过程会消耗一定的时间和资源。当递归算法的深度增加时,函数调用的次数也会增加,从而导致延迟的累积。

延迟的大小取决于计算机的性能和递归算法的复杂度。如果计算机性能较好且递归算法较简单,延迟可能较小,反之则可能较大。为了减小延迟,可以优化递归算法的实现,减少函数调用的次数或者使用尾递归优化等技术手段。

递归算法在实际应用中有许多场景,例如树的遍历、图的搜索、排序算法等。在这些场景下,递归算法可以简洁地表达问题的解决思路,并且具有较好的可读性和可维护性。

对于云计算领域,腾讯云提供了一系列与计算资源相关的产品,如云服务器、容器服务、函数计算等。这些产品可以满足不同规模和需求的计算任务,并提供高可用性、弹性扩展和安全性等特性。具体产品介绍和链接如下:

  1. 云服务器(Elastic Compute Cloud,ECS):提供可弹性调整的虚拟服务器实例,支持多种操作系统和应用场景。详情请参考:云服务器产品介绍
  2. 容器服务(Tencent Kubernetes Engine,TKE):基于Kubernetes的容器管理服务,提供高可用、弹性伸缩的容器集群。详情请参考:容器服务产品介绍
  3. 函数计算(Serverless Cloud Function,SCF):无需管理服务器的事件驱动计算服务,支持按需执行代码逻辑。详情请参考:函数计算产品介绍

通过使用腾讯云的计算产品,用户可以灵活地部署和管理计算资源,提高应用的性能和可靠性,实现云计算的各种应用场景。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券